Right click on the link and select Display Options.

Make sure that Show Surface is set to True.

Sure do, until I changed Show Surface to False. Then it looked like your screenshot in post #7.

Note that Draw Surface on the link properties is not the same as Show Surface in the Display Options.

The first is an FS setting, the second is an ADE setting.
